Who funds Rm Pyles Boys Camp?

Rm Pyles Boys Camp is funded by 18 grantmakers, led by The Wood-claeyssens Foundation ($140K), Jw and Ida M Jameson Foundation ($120K), Macdonald Family Foundation ($65K). In total, IRS Form 990 filings record $748K in grants to Rm Pyles Boys Camp between 2019–2025.
